Navigating Visa Types: Selecting the Right Path
Managing the multifaceted landscape of visa types is an crucial step for enterprises engaging in global mobility. Each visa category serves particular purposes, such as work, study, or tourism, making it essential for businesses to align their objectives with the correct visa type. Standard options include temporary work visas, which authorize employees to perform particular roles for a finite time, and permanent residency visas, which permit long-term stays and employment.
Organizations must consider factors such as the destination country's requirements, the nature of the work, and the period of stay. Moreover, understanding the application process and required documentation is fundamental to prevent delays. By carefully analyzing these elements, companies can optimize their global mobility strategies, maintaining compliance and facilitating easier transitions for their employees. How Much Time Does the Visa Process Usually Take?
The visa procedure generally requires between a couple of weeks to multiple months, based on the country, type of visa, and specific circumstances. Applicants should prepare for potential delays and extra paperwork requests.
What Are the Expenses Related to Global Mobility Services?
Expenses related to global mobility services vary substantially, depending on aspects such as destination, service complexity, and specific requirements. Fees may include application fees, legal consultancy, and additional support services, potentially reaching thousands of dollars.
Can I Work While My Visa Is Pending?
Usually, people may not work when their visa is being processed unless they maintain a valid work permit or their current visa allows it. Laws change by country, so it is important to verify local immigration policies.
What Happens Should My Visa Be Denied?
Should a visa be denied, the individual will typically receive a written explanation outlining the reasons. They can usually contest the ruling or reapply, but must tackle the issues identified in the denial notice.
What's the Method to Track My Visa Status?
Applicants may monitor their visa status online via the official government immigration website, utilizing their application reference number. In addition, contacting the consulate or embassy directly for updates is also an effective option.
